Authorities have identified the man who was killed when, police said, a driver intentionally rammed the pickup truck he was driving early Sunday.

Eduardo A. Pena, 21, was identified as the fatality, the Cook County medical examiner’s office said.

He died after the vehicle pushed his 1998 Ford Ranger truck more than two blocks, until it struck a tree, police said. Pena was pronounced dead at 4:44 a.m. after he was rushed to Stroger Hospital in critical condition.

Pena’s car came to a stop in the 5700 block of South Kedzie Avenue in the South Side’s Gage Park neighborhood around 2:15 a.m. Pena lived just a little more than a mile away in the 5300 block of South Fairfield Avenue.

Chicago police are searching for the person who hit the truck in what they have characterized as a homicide investigation.
